Have any of you who have done femurs use any muscle relaxers during your lengthening phase? I will be at that 5-6 CM point before I know it, and will likely be tight in the quads and hamstrings. I will be doing PT 5 times per week but it may not be enough to avoid bent knee and the tightness, I want to make sure I push through to 7.6 CM.
Did any of you use muscle relaxers to help push through the final phase of consolidation? My Dr. gave me 5MG Flexeril the first week after surgery, as I was having painful spasms in my left left. When the spasms went away I stopped taking the flexeril. I don't know that they helped much though. Any of you have any experience with muscle relaxers?
